Akbolto. Damage just a little less than the hand-cannons like the Lex, Seer, and Vastos, fire-rate just shy of the auto-pistols (though it's semi-auto and you can't really click that fast), and it's firing sounds are pure sex. Good clip size and virtually no recoil, too.

i always have my beloved Gremlins with me.

 

 

however, provided you have mechanical fingers, AkBolto's are downright absurd at how good they can be. just note that their RoF is higher than any human being can press a button. so you'll always be under your 'potential' Damage Output.

 

note though - Weapons that are highly focused on one Physical type will have trouble against the other two factions if they don't have Elementals targeted against the currently fought Faction.

Since I didn't get the Brakk, I ground away to get the Bronco Prime, which I really like. It's damage is biased to Impact, but it does enough damage to make all your elemental mods do very impressive damage. It's like a mini-Hek as a sidearm, and this makes me happy.

Of the weapons you can get from the Market, I'd have to vote for the AkLex, or the Stug. Of the weapons you can find, if you haven't gotten your hands on the Bronco Prime yet, I'd vote for the Twin Gremlins, for the reasons others have stated in this thread.

My vote is for Akvasto . Mod for magnetic - corrosive/blast damage or crit, either way does well. It's high slash damage works well vs. all factions.

Acrid is also extremely nice , nuf said.

Skipped the Akbolto but plan to craft asap as I've been reading good things about it.

I do like the Dual Broncos vs.Corpus, not so much vs. Grineer, and the low clip size annoys me.

I'm somehow astonished that nobody mentioned the Marelok yet. Sadly I am a bit cursed from being unable to obtain the Brakk in the Gravidus Dilemma event, so there's that to consider.

Marelok Pros- Unusually high Impact and Slash damage, making it a flexible power-pistol in most missions. Faster RoF and reload time than the Lex. Free Attack Polarity slot. High Status chance for any Secondary. Not a Shotgun so it doesn't suffer from damage falloff like the Brakk does.

Marelok Woes- Is a Clan Tech weapon, thus its BP has the Clan requisites attached to it. Requires Mastery Rank 5 and a Forma to build. Neither a Shotgun nor a bullet-hose secondary, so it requires at least decent user accuracy to maximize its DPS. Requires more Forma to maximize its potential compared to the Brakk. Has a rather small magazine. (...although the Brakk also has a small magazine.)

Considerations- Mastery Rank 5 could be easily attainable for any dilligent Warframe player. I would have thrown in "Needs two Detonite Injectors" as a Con, but Invasions have made it easy to acquire the needed amount of Clan Tech resources in a short period of time. (That is if the RNG gods are generous enough. Usually they are when it comes to Clan Tech resources.) An atypically flexible handcannon due to its high Impact+Slash combo, the Marelok gives you the choice of either maximizing its per-shot damage by stacking all elemental+physical+utility damage mods, increasing its damage sustain with firerate+reload speed mods, or mixing-and-matching both styles of modding to suit your mission needs.

I actually have a quad-Forma'd Marelok now (3x Attack and 2x Utility slots), and I can happily say that the resulting mini-cannon was worth the investment. Definitely a fun handcannon, with a neat lever-action animation to boot.
